President Moon: "Icheon Fire, Heavy Responsibility... On Buddha's Birthday, a Pledge for 'Life and Safety'"
[Asia Economy Reporter Son Sunhee] On the 30th, marking Buddha's Birthday, President Moon Jae-in said, "A compassionate heart that regards the pain of neighbors as my own pain is our strength and hope," adding, "On the occasion of Buddha's Birthday, we reaffirm our commitment to a country where life and safety come first."
On the same day, President Moon posted on his Facebook under the title "When neighbors are in pain, I am in pain too," stating, "Many people lost their lives in the Icheon fire," and "It is very unfortunate that such a tragedy occurred while everyone is working hard to overcome the novel coronavirus infection (COVID-19), and I feel an even greater sense of responsibility." He continued, "I deeply mourn those who suffered from this unexpected accident and wish for the speedy recovery of the injured," and expressed gratitude, saying, "I also thank the firefighters who worked hard for extinguishing the fire and rescue."
President Moon said, "On the morning of Buddha's Birthday, the hearts of Buddhists and monks must also be uneasy," and added, "I hope that with Buddha's compassionate heart, they will pray for the repose of the deceased and comfort the bereaved families."
He stated, "Whenever the country faces difficulties, Buddhism has united the hearts of the people to overcome national crises and shared the pain," and regarding the COVID-19 situation, he said, "Even now, through the practice of 'clean temple,' social distancing is being maintained, leading the efforts to overcome the infectious disease." He also expressed appreciation, saying, "Buddhists embrace neighbors in need through donations and sharing, and monks have returned their alms and opened temple stays free of charge for exhausted medical workers," adding, "The warm heart of the Buddhist community has always been a strength to the people."
Furthermore, he said, "From today until the 30th of next month, when the Buddha's Birthday celebration ceremony will be held, temples nationwide will begin 'prayers for healing and overcoming COVID-19,'" and quoted Ven. Beopjeong's words, "'The time and place where one practices Buddha's wisdom and love is the place where Buddha comes,' saying that every day sharing joy and hope, sorrow and worries with the people will be Buddha's Birthday."

President Moon concluded his message by saying, "We will overcome COVID-19 and the sorrow of the Icheon fire and surely create our new daily life," and "On Buddha's Birthday, I pray that the hearts of mutual reliance and encouragement deepen and that the pain is healed by Buddha's 'great compassion'."
